Tender description
Community Ophthalmology Service for Shropshire CCG and Telford & Wrekin CCG. The CCG is seeking to procure a Lead Provider, who is able to deliver a Community Ophthalmology Service to meet the health needs of the local population of Shropshire and Telford and Wrekin Clinical Commissioning Groups through a Community based delivery model and use of innovative service re-design. The Commissioner wishes to receive responses to the Invitation to Tender (ITT) from suitably qualified and experienced Ophthalmology providers with the necessary capacity and capability (or a demonstrable ability to provide the necessary capacity and capability) to provide a Community Ophthalmology Service. The Service shall deliver a ‘one stop shop’ service, with diagnostic and clinical assessments being undertaken at the same appointment, to ensure timely access to specialist clinical expertise in a community setting. The Service Provider shall be expected to work with the Commissioner to develop the processes necessary for further ophthalmic conditions to be treated/managed in a Community Based Ophthalmology care setting throughout the duration of the contract. The Service shall:- — Provide timely access to specialist clinical expertise in a community setting. — Deliver a ‘one-stop shop’ service with diagnostic and clinical assessments being undertaken at the same appointment. — Improve access and reduce waiting times for ophthalmic services, with a flexible appointment system to meet the needs of Service Users and carers. — Provide advice, information and support to primary care practitioners. — Support and enable Service Users to manage their own conditions by providing a supportive and proactive approach to self-management and to signpost Service Users to services that can support them to self-manage. — Ensure Certification of Vision impairment is completed and provision of support aids where required. — Provide a Service that is multi-disciplinary and patient focused. — Provide access to high quality, safe clinical care that gives timely advice, appropriate support, assessment, diagnostics and treatment for patients according to their individual need. — Provide care closer to home, where appropriate. — Commission a high quality service that integrates with other providers. — Generate a reduction in unnecessary out-patient appointments. — Create a Service that uses innovative methods of service delivery.
